Do you remember the post we ran in May about how cell phones are likely responsible for mass honey bee death? Well, our phones have been pardoned…for now.

The New York Times reports on a band of military scientists and entomologists who have pinpointed two other suspects: Fungus and a virus. How the two work together to kill the bees remains a question, but scientists are looking into it. Although the findings don’t totally solve the bee mystery, at least I can feel guilty about one less thing in life — my iPhone is not a murderer.
